Total Crime Rate
125.8 per 1,000
All offences · Oct 2024 - Sep 2025Little London area has the 12th highest crime rate of 53 local areas in Carisbrooke & Gunville , and the 68th highest crime rate of 469 local areas in Isle of Wight .
Neighbouring streets tend to have noticeably higher crime levels than this postcode. Crime here is lower than the average for the surrounding output areas.
The overall crime rate in the area around Little London (PO30 5XT) in the last 12 months was 125.8 per 1,000 residents and was 96.1% higher than the Carisbrooke & Gunville average (64.1 per 1,000 residents). In the last 12 months, this area’s most reported crimes were Anti-social behaviour with 4 offences recorded. The least common crime was Burglary with 1 case , down -50.0% compared to 2024. The fastest-growing crime category was Possession of weapons ( 100.0% YoY). The sharpest decline was Criminal damage and arson ( -75.0% YoY).
Violent crimes totalled 7 (≈ 41.9 per 1,000 residents). Year-over-year these were falling ( -30.0% ). Over the last decade, overall crime has rising ( 41.0% comparing early vs recent averages) .
In the area around Little London (PO30 5XT), the main crime hotspot is near East Street. Police recorded 214 crimes here, including 116 violent or public-order offences. All these locations are within roughly 0.3 miles.
